## Changelog — Font vendoring defaults changed

As of this release, the Bracken UI build no longer fetches third-party fonts at build time. All typefaces used by the Lanternwell suite are now vendored into the repo under a dedicated assets directory, and the fetch step is skipped by default. If you're onboarding, nothing to install — the fonts travel with the checkout. The build flags controlling this behavior are listed below.

settings of hadup-yafog:
LAMAEL_PIN=3761
LAMAEL_TENANT=istmir
LAMAEL_METRICS_HOST=metrics.lamael.plorvasys.test
LAMAEL_SEAL=seal_8ea68500
LAMAEL_STANDBY_TEAM=fraok

**Planner regression — act fast.** Harrowdb 4.2 started choosing nested-loop joins on the Ledgerline reporting queries. Symptom: p99 jumps past 8s on `daily_rollup`. Mitigation: set `planner.force_hash_joins=true` in the Tollgate config and restart the read replicas only. Do not touch the primary. Confirm latency recovers within ten minutes, then escalate to Ines for a proper fix. Pin the incident to the build token below.

build token for yajof-bajof: htk31_506ff1188f74596b5bb2eec94edc43c

Subject: Canary gating cut-over complete

Hi all — the Pellwick deploy pipeline now enforces the new canary gating rules. Canaries must pass error-rate and latency checks for fifteen minutes before promotion; failures trigger automatic rollback. Manual overrides require two approvers. New team members should read the gating doc before their first deploy. The gate controller currently runs with these values.

deployment values, yahag-tawef:
ZORWYN_HOST=zorwyn.tolvaqlabs.internal
ZORWYN_PORT=9300

## Authentication

The nightly reindex pipeline for Quillstack Search requires authenticated calls to the internal Indexrunner service. Plugin hooks fire after segment merge; unauthenticated hooks are dropped silently. Scope your requests to the reindex namespace only — broader scopes are rejected. Tokens rotate monthly; watch the changelog. Authenticate every request with the key provided directly below.

app token of fahip-badug = kto15_1KZslTEs4APfT3d